The gene expression profiles of maturing osteoclasts (OCs) co-cultured with prostate cancer (PCa) cell lines.

GSE268422 Mus musculus Expression profiling by high throughput sequencing 8 samples Submitted 2024/06/06 Platform GPL19057
Summary
Bone metastatic lesions of PCa contain areas of bone destruction and formation that are directed by OCs and osteoblasts (OBs), respectively. Bone resorption induced by OCs is a necessary priming event for tumor progression in PCa bone metastasis.; however, the characteristics of OCs affected by PCa have not been fully elucidated. Here, we performed NGS analysis to investigate the characteristics of OCs in the presence of PCa.
